Spring delusions is a short poetry book written by zahra ammar. I can honestly say that a poetry book isn’t something i would normally choose to read. I have often found that i don’t always understand where the poet is trying to go with their thoughts, but i didn’t have this issue with these poems.
Ammar shows an abundance of each of these traits in creating spring delusions: chaotic poems of despair and blooming hope. Utilizing timely pop-culture, mythological, and literary references, ammar wrestles with the chaos of describing enigmatic emotional states and succeeds on multiple fronts.

Title: spring delusions: chaotic poems of despair and blooming hope author: zahra ammar genre: poetry release date: september 19th, 2016 add to goodreads description: words are our only tools to express the physicality of the chaos in our minds.
All within 2016, she moved to a different country and became a self-published writer with her first book of poetry, also called spring delusions. When most people get completely broken down from stressful situations, ammar gets things done.
